If you’re going to be out in the brisk, fresh air you may as well make the most of it and take your bike – or hire one when you get here – and cycle along the gorgeous historic Viking Coastal Trail. What really makes this lovely route stand out above the many others in Kent is that it is mostly traffic free, so it’s ideal for beginners, families and for those who just prefer the sights, sounds and smells of nature rather than cars and trucks. Although the trail is a mighty 32-miles long, it is easy to split it into manageable chunks, ensuring that you get to see Thanet at its best at a pace that suits you. However, why just visit a beach when you can explore it? Which is exactly what the Coastal Explorer Pack allows you to do. All along the natural coastline of Thanet you can find a rich heritage and plenty of exciting stories, and these fantastic packs give you the tools and the clues to get to the discoveries beneath your feet and all around. The packs are filled with equipment for a full morning or afternoon of fun and can teach anyone who tries them out some truly essential explorer skills including how to make a sundial, how to use a compass, and how to identify marine life. Become a rocky shore researcher, make sand art, play hopscotch and plenty more besides. These unique and thrilling Coastal Explorer Packs can be hired for just £5 each (with proof of ID).
